New Delhi - We must create awareness about the disastrous effects of tobacco consumption among the youths, says Bollywood singer Shaan, who Thursday launched the song “Life Se Panga Mat Le Yaar†to spread the message.
"We must create awareness about the disastrous effects of tobacco consumption, especially among the young generation of the nation," said the singer who has associated himself with the Salaam Bombay Foundation to create awareness about ill effects of tobacco consumption.
"A word of awareness should be spread around in the best possible way to stop the consumption of tobacco by children and music is the only language that can reach all age groups... it has no barriers," he added.
Last year, the ministry of health and family welfare appointed Shaan as the tobacco control ambassador of India.
The song will be aired on all major music channels Feb 2. The music stations are already airing it since Jan 28.
The 3.48-minute track has been sung and composed by Shaan himself and the lyrics are written by Rekha Nigam, who penned songs for films like “Parineeta†and “Laaga Chunari Mein Daagâ€.
The music video features Shaan singing and dancing with street kids to catchy and foot tapping beats of “Life Se Panga Mat Le Yaarâ€.
